2026/4/18 14:11:06
网站建设
项目流程
哪里网站海报做的比较好,网页设计师的主要工作,seo排名优化推广教程,网站功能板块开源眼动追踪技术#xff1a;用视线控制你的计算机 【免费下载链接】eyetracker Take images of an eyereflections and find on-screen gaze points. 项目地址: https://gitcode.com/gh_mirrors/ey/eyetracker
eyetracker是一款基于计算机视觉的开源眼动追踪系统…开源眼动追踪技术用视线控制你的计算机【免费下载链接】eyetrackerTake images of an eyereflections and find on-screen gaze points.项目地址: https://gitcode.com/gh_mirrors/ey/eyetrackereyetracker是一款基于计算机视觉的开源眼动追踪系统能够通过普通摄像头捕捉眼睛图像和反射点精确计算用户在屏幕上的注视位置。这个项目采用了先进的瞳孔-角膜反射技术为残障人士辅助技术、人机交互研究和创新应用开发提供了强大的技术支撑。项目核心亮点零配置自动运行与其他眼动追踪工具不同eyetracker的设计目标是无需用户手动调整参数即可正常工作。系统自动初始化摄像头设备完成九点校准流程建立映射关系。高精度实时追踪系统采用先进的图像处理算法能够以60Hz的采样率实时追踪眼球运动延迟控制在50ms以内。通过检测瞳孔轮廓和角膜反射点的相对位置实现精准的注视点定位。跨平台兼容性项目支持Windows、macOS和Linux三大主流操作系统通过Xcode项目配置文件和CMake构建系统开发者可以在不同平台上轻松编译和部署应用。快速安装与配置环境准备清单带摄像头的计算机内置或外置均可C编译环境推荐GCC或ClangOpenCV计算机视觉库OpenFrameworks创意编程框架CMake构建工具源码获取与编译git clone https://gitcode.com/gh_mirrors/ey/eyetracker cd eyetracker mkdir build cd build cmake .. make -j4首次使用流程运行编译生成的可执行文件程序自动初始化摄像头设备完成九点校准流程建立映射关系注视屏幕任意位置光标自动跟随移动技术原理深度解析eyetracker的核心技术基于瞳孔-角膜反射法这是一种被广泛使用的非侵入式眼动追踪技术。图像采集与预处理系统通过摄像头连续采集眼部图像在src/cvEyeTracker.cpp中实现图像灰度化、噪声过滤和对比度增强等预处理操作为后续分析提供高质量的图像数据。特征检测与定位瞳孔检测通过阈值分割和轮廓分析算法定位瞳孔区域反射点识别检测角膜上的红外光源反射点相对位置计算通过瞳孔中心与反射点的相对位置关系确定注视方向坐标映射与校准系统采用透视变换算法将眼部特征坐标映射到屏幕坐标系。校准过程通过记录多个已知屏幕位置对应的眼部特征建立精确的映射关系。实际应用场景医疗辅助技术为运动障碍患者提供全新的计算机操作方式通过眼球运动实现文字输入、网页浏览和软件操作显著提升生活质量。游戏交互创新游戏开发者可以基于eyetracker开发视线控制的游戏体验玩家通过注视不同区域实现游戏操作创造前所未有的沉浸感。用户体验研究企业可用eyetracker分析用户对网站或应用的视觉注意力分布优化界面设计和内容布局提升产品使用体验。教育与培训在教育领域通过记录学生的注视轨迹分析学习过程中的注意力变化为教学方法和内容优化提供数据支持。使用技巧与优化建议追踪精度优化确保环境光线均匀避免强光直射定期重新校准系统保持最佳性能使用过程中保持头部相对稳定设备兼容性配置使用720p以上分辨率的摄像头确保摄像头驱动正常安装调整摄像头位置获得清晰的眼部图像使用体验改善合理安排使用时间每30分钟休息5-10分钟调整屏幕亮度和对比度减少眼睛疲劳保持适当的观看距离二次开发指南核心类结构解析项目的主要功能集中在cvEyeTracker类中该类继承自ofBaseApp提供了完整的眼动追踪功能框架。关键方法说明findPupil()瞳孔检测核心算法findPerkinje()角膜反射点识别calcPerspectiveMap()坐标映射计算扩展功能开发开发者可以基于现有的眼动追踪功能开发更多创新的应用场景如视线控制的游戏、智能家居控制等。社区资源与学习路径eyetracker作为开源项目欢迎开发者参与贡献。项目采用MIT许可证允许自由使用、修改和分发。参与方式提交bug修复和改进建议优化核心算法提升性能开发图形界面和可视化工具编写技术文档和使用教程学习资源核心源码src/cvEyeTracker.cpp头文件定义src/cvEyeTracker.h主程序入口src/main.cpp项目配置Project.xcconfig未来发展趋势随着计算机视觉技术和人工智能算法的不断进步眼动追踪技术将在精度、速度和易用性方面持续提升。eyetracker作为一个基础平台为更多创新应用的开发提供了技术基础。通过这款功能强大的开源眼动追踪工具你可以轻松构建个性化的视线交互应用。无论是学术研究、产品开发还是个人项目eyetracker都能为你提供可靠的技术支持。【免费下载链接】eyetrackerTake images of an eyereflections and find on-screen gaze points.项目地址: https://gitcode.com/gh_mirrors/ey/eyetracker创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考